Bio | Hi I am Shyaonti, a published author, columnist voiceover artist and film critic. Wrote a screenplay and did voiceover for a webseries Soundairya’s Experiments (genre: feminist erotica) streaming on AITAP. Right now developing my own scripts and screen adaptations of books. This is my brief bio: Assistant Professor of English Language and Literature under university of Pune, Master Trainer, South Asia for Cambridge English Language Assessment, a division of the University of Cambridge, UK, a Materials Development Consultant and Trainer for British Council, a resource person for the Government of India’s digital learning platform Swayam and Burlington English, Dr. Shyaonti Talwar holds a Ph.D from the University of Mumbai. Dr. Talwar’s areas of research interest include Gender studies, women’s writing, subaltern studies, post-colonial studies, literary theory, myths and archetypes, cultural studies, film studies and English Language and Literature Teaching. Dr. Talwar has worked extensively with the print media, authored books on Communication Skills and ELT published by Cambridge University Press and on mineral stones in the Deccan Plateau of India called “Stunning Stones” catalogued in the Smithsonian Museum. She is a resource person, board of studies member, subject expert and consultant to many universities and academic bodies and has written and published several research papers and chapters in books on the areas of research interest mentioned above. Besides this, she has designed and reviewed several language learning and enhancement modules for teachers, students and professionals. She has also conducted multiple series of training programmes for educators in language skills, classroom management, teaching learning strategies, critical thinking, research theories, literary criticism across India and South Asia. Dr. Talwar is an active blogger, a trained voiceover artist and a professional practitioner of the classical dance form of Kathak. She writes regularly for the reputed digital papers The Wire and Feminism in India and occasionally for Café Dissensus and Women’s web. She conducts workshops and gives talks extensively on Mythology, Popular Culture, Gender Studies, Feminist Theory and Praxis and Language Pedagogy. She has authored the book The Devi in the Diva which looks at Goddess archetypes and their manifestation in popular cinematic texts which was run as a film analysis and appreciation course by Auroville Film Institute, Pondicherry. She is also one of the course designers for the Diploma in Film Studies to be introduced by Mumbai University. Her debut book in fiction writing called Soundairya’s Experiments is available on Amazon. Her debut book of poems is in the pipeline and will be released soon. Dr. Talwar is invested in issues and causes concerning social justice and most of her posts on social media and the papers she has written are dedicated to this.
